About One Day Agency
One Day Agency is an integrated advertising and marketing agency with offices in Manchester, London, Paris, and Warsaw. In just six years, we’ve built a team of 20 dynamic professionals working with brands of all sizes across the Globe, from small e-commerce businesses to F1 teams. We specialise in delivering high-impact advertising campaigns across OOH, TV, Radio, and digital channels, helping brands grow through strategic media planning and buying.
The Role
We’re looking for a Junior OR Senior Growth Manager with at least 2 years of agency experience across OOH and wider ATL media channels to join our fast-paced Growth Team. You’ll take full ownership of inbound client inquiries - converting leads, pitching media plans, and delivering advertising campaigns across multiple channels. This role is perfect for someone who thrives in a collaborative, high-energy environment, is eager to learn about all forms of media, and can independently manage campaigns from start to finish.

Salary & Benefits
- Salary: £30,000 to £45,000 base + uncapped commissions (up to £50,000 potential, avg. £15,000 first year).
- Flexible Work: WFH every Friday + 20 additional WFH days per year.
- Annual Leave: Up to 30 days.
- Professional Growth: Unlimited training and development budget.
- Top-tier office setup with high-end equipment.
